Jiddu Krishnamurti fue considerado a nivel mundial como uno de los grandes pensadores y maestros religiosos de todos los tiempos. No exponía ninguna filosofía o religión, sino que hablaba de las preocupaciones de nuestra vida cotidiana, los desafíos de la sociedad moderna con su violencia y corrupción, la búsqueda individual de seguridad y felicidad, y la necesidad de la humanidad de liberarse de las cargas internas de miedo, ira, dolor y tristeza. Explicó con precisión el funcionamiento sutil de la mente humana, enfatizando la necesidad de aportar una cualidad profundamente meditativa y espiritual a la vida diaria. Sus enseñanzas, relevantes para la era moderna, son atemporales y universales.







Krishnamurti's essential message is that to find truth, we must go beyond the limits of ordinary thought. In public talks worldwide, he strove to free listeners from conventional beliefs and psychological mind-sets in order to understand what is. This 3-volume series records his meetings with individual seekers from all walks of life, during which he comments on the struggles common to those who work to break the boundaries of personality and self-limitation. This second volume of the 3-part series includes discussions of creative happiness, devotion, worship, the fear of death, karma and an experience of bliss.

Jiddu Krishnamurti, once heralded as a World Leader by the Theosophical Society, shares profound insights in this collection of 88 essays. He explores universal themes such as gossip, wealth disparity, virtue, love, belief, and fear, offering reflections that resonate with the human experience. Through his thought-provoking commentary, he encourages readers to confront and understand the complexities of life, making this work a relevant guide for personal growth and self-awareness.

This comprehensive record of Krishnamurti's teachings is an excellent, wide-ranging introduction to the great philosopher's thought. With among others, Jacob Needleman, Alain Naude, and Swami Venkatasananda, Krishnamurti examines such issues as the role of the teacher and tradition; the need for awareness of 'cosmic consciousness; the problem of good and evil; and traditional Vedanta methods of help for different levels of seekers.
